So I just wanted to know if there are any site rules on fans of particular stories carrying them on after they're essentially "dead" and the author/s have stopped updating them? Is that against the rules or not?

For example, if someone wanted to carry on "The Prodigal Princess" or "Master and Servant", is that allowed? Say for instance if for a story like that, someone titled a new chapter/part: "Master And Servant - Fan Continuation" and then wrote several of their own additional chapters. Is that okay? Yay or nay?

Personally, I would attempt to get permission from the original author if possible - not because I think it’s a “must”, just that it would be polite and good manners to do so. 

Otherwise I would do as suggested above. Create a new thread making it clear that it is based on or a continuation of another author’s work with a link to the original story. 

Not sure what the rules are but I think this would be good practice and that no reasonable person would be too upset if you did this.
